2. Key Vital Signs

Metric Value (£) Interpretation
Fixed Assets 900 Minimal investment in long-term assets, typical for micro businesses or early stage.
Current Assets 2,286 Very low liquid and receivable assets, limited buffer for short-term obligations.
Current Liabilities 4,849 Short-term debts exceed current assets by £2,563, indicating liquidity strain.
Net Current Assets (Working Capital) -2,563 Negative working capital, a critical red flag indicating potential cash flow problems.
Total Assets Less Current Liabilities -1,663 Company’s net asset position is negative, indicating liabilities exceed assets.
Shareholders Funds (Equity) -1,663 Negative equity position signals accumulated losses or undercapitalisation.

3. Diagnosis: What the Numbers Reveal

  • Liquidity Symptoms: The company is showing a "symptom of distress" in its liquidity position, with current liabilities nearly twice the current assets. This means LBK ENTERPRISES LTD may struggle to meet short-term obligations as they fall due, risking supplier payment delays or credit issues.

  • Solvency Concerns: Negative shareholders’ funds indicate insolvency on a balance sheet basis. This suggests the company has either incurred losses since inception or has been financed through debt beyond its asset base, which is a "warning sign" for creditors and investors.

  • Operational Stage: Given the company was incorporated recently (October 2022) and is classified as a micro-entity, this financial snapshot might reflect the early investment and initial operating costs prior to achieving steady revenue and profitability.

  • Capital Structure: The 75-100% ownership by a single individual and a controlling firm implies concentrated control, which can facilitate swift decision-making but also concentrates financial risk.
